一年一度,十二分火爆的十一,举国同庆的国庆节,终于结束了。玩的玩完了,赚的赚满了,该干啥干啥,一切回归原样。
说实话,像十一这种全国放假的所谓“旅游黄金周”,真的没有兴趣去旅游。因为,“人”实在是太多啦!所谓的“旅游”完全是看人,至于&ldquo
原创
2010-10-10 17:05:39
341阅读
点赞
3评论
今天,我们来学习类的基本定义和使用。1.定义类如何定义一个类呢?class 类名:
属性和方法定义照此格式,定义一个Animal类:class Animal:
pass(先用pass来占位) 将一个dog变量进行赋值:dog = Animal()为其设置属性:dog.name = "Bobby"
dog.age = 5打印关于它的信息:print("小狗的名字是", dog.name)
pri
转载
2023-12-23 20:57:10
267阅读
文章目录一、多态性二、鸭子类型三、绑定方法1、问题引入2、绑定给类的方法四、非绑定方法 一、多态性多态指的是一类事物有多种形态,比如动物有多种形态:猫、狗、猪class Animal: # 同一类事物:动物
def talk(self):
pass
class Cat(Animal): # 动物的形态之一:猫
def talk(self): # 重写父类talk方
转载
2024-01-08 13:17:38
433阅读
多重继承继承是面向对象编程的一个重要的方式,因为通过继承,子类可以扩展父类的功能。Animal类的层次设计,假设要实现以下4中动物:Dog - 狗狗;Bat - 蝙蝠;Parrot - 鹦鹉;Ostrich - 鸵鸟如果按照哺乳类和鸟类来分:如果按照“能跑”和“能飞”来归类,就应该设计出下图这样的类层次:如果把上面的两种分类都包含进来,就得设计更多的层次:哺乳类:能跑的哺乳类,能飞的哺乳类;鸟类:
转载
2023-12-10 02:13:56
136阅读
1.前言 每个代理类只能为一个接口服务,这样程序开发中必然会产生许多的代理类. 所以我们就会想办法可以通过一个代理类完成全部的代理功能,那么我们就需要用动态代理 2.在Java中要想实现动态代理机制,需要 接口和 类的支持 接口的定义如下: 类的定义如下: 注:动态代理类只能代理接口(不支持抽象类)
原创
2021-07-15 16:40:48
463阅读
### Android WindowManager手指一动view实现教程
作为一名经验丰富的开发者,我将教会你如何实现“android WindowManager手指一动view”的效果。首先,我们来看一下整个实现的流程图:
```mermaid
flowchart TD
A(创建WindowManager) --> B(创建View)
B --> C(设置触摸监听)
原创
2024-05-05 04:13:10
67阅读
抽象工厂(abstact_foctory)模式抽象工厂是什么抽象工厂是为了提供一个创建一系列相关或相互依赖对象的接口,而无需指定它们具体的类。例子我创建了一个抽象工厂类,它的表现取决于我们选择什么工厂来初始化它。例子中,抽象工厂类是宠物店(PetShop),它有一个动作(show_pet)用来展示动物,我们如果用猫(Cat)初始化宠物店,展示时,它会”喵呜“。代码实现例子import random
转载
2023-12-27 12:39:54
87阅读
继承是面向对象编程的一个重要的方式,因为通过继承,子类就可以扩展父类的功能。回忆一下Animal类层次的设计,假如我们要实现以下4种动物:Dog——狗;Bat——蝙蝠;Parrot——鹦鹉Ostrich——鸵鸟如果按照不如动物和鸟类归类,我们可以设计出这样的类的层次:但是如果按照“能跑”和“能飞”来归类,我们就应该设计出这样的类的层次:如果要把上面的两种分类都包含进来,我们就得设计更多的层次:哺乳
转载
2023-12-10 08:08:48
215阅读
# MySQL Source 一动不动
。在MySQL中,`source`命令是一个非常有用的工具,可以用来执行外部文件中的SQL语句。本文将介绍MySQL的`source`命令及其用法,并提供一些代码示例来展示如何使用该命令。
## 什么是`source`命令?
`source
原创
2023-12-27 04:08:38
85阅读
多态概念 多态性在现实生活中很普遍。动物都有交生,虽然都是“叫”,但叫声是多种多样的,列如,狗、猫、鸟、狼、狮子等叫声各不相同,即“叫”这个动作效果不同;又如,计算面积,但是长方形、圆、三角形的面积计算公式也不相同。这就是多态。示例我们先定义一个类Animal,然后Cat和Dog类继承Animal。cla
转载
2023-12-07 09:42:59
85阅读
://my.oschina.net/andy0807/blog/86342://hi.baidu.com/jadmin/item/24568f24d4ff9d8c9c63d1e3://blog..net/tjcyjd/article/details/6848108ht...
转载
2014-04-24 20:04:00
49阅读
1.类与实例1.1创建类和子类类使用class关键字创建,类的属性和方法被列在一个缩进块中。class animals:
pass
#“哺乳动物”是“动物”的子类
class mammals(animals):
pass
class dog(mammals):
pass子类mammals可以继承父类animals的所有属性,同样,子类dog也可以继承父类mammals的所有属性。1.2增加属于类的
转载
2024-01-29 15:11:19
83阅读
# Python动作检测:计算同一动作持续时间
## 引言
随着机器学习和计算机视觉的快速发展,动作检测成为了一个热门的研究领域。动作检测可以应用于许多领域,如运动分析、人体姿势识别和手势控制等。在本篇文章中,我们将使用Python来演示如何检测同一动作的持续时间。我们将使用OpenCV库来处理视频数据,并使用简单的算法来检测同一动作的开始和结束。
## 动作检测原理
动作检测的目标是在视
原创
2023-09-15 06:52:12
261阅读
效果 代码在下面,可跳过解析。前言编程实现一个时钟利用Swing绘制一个时钟,只能是静态的。利用Calendar类获取当前的时分秒,然后根据数学公式绘制相应的时钟就可以了。如果静态的时钟已经足够你使用,那么就无须用到线程的概念。如何让时钟“动起来”当然了,动起来肯定是不可能的,但是我们可以利用人眼的视觉,让时钟“好像动起来”,其实着很简单,只要让当前的图像每隔一秒种刷新一次就可以了。这样秒针在动,
继承:实现代买的重用 相同的代码不需要重复的写概念理解: 类似于祖辈留下的遗产,父辈可以使用,父辈留下的东西,子辈可以使用,这就是继承。例如:建立一个动物类,猫也是一个动物,所以猫也具有动物的属性:class Animal: #定义一个动物类
def eat(self):
print('吃饭')
def drink(self)
转载
2024-01-17 10:25:54
81阅读
我们说过,Python中一切都是对象,这些对象都是类的实例。这么多的类,每个类都是从头开始创建的吗?比如说,我要给小猫咪创建一个类,要给小狮子创建一个类,还要给小老虎创建一个类。代码量好像有点大呀,有没有方法能提高效率呢?小伙伴们直观的去想一下,小猫咪、小狮子、小老虎它们之间是完全不一样的吗?当然不是啦,他们也是有一些共同之处,生物好的小伙伴们也许就要抢答啦,它们都是猫科动物!对啊,要说起来它们都
转载
2023-11-27 10:04:29
198阅读
坚持创新是第一动力创新,对我们国家,乃至全世界出现频率非常高的一个词。创新,是引领发展的第一动力,是人类迈进美好生活的前提。从第一次工业革命的蒸汽机,再到第四次工业革命的人工智能,人类文明的发展就是一部不断超越、不断创新的历史。为什么需要创新思维?创新需要创新思维。而创新思维就是破除迷信、超越过时陈规,善于因时制宜、知难而进、开拓创新的思维方式。一个人拥有创新思维,就不会盲目迷信权威、缺乏独立思考
原创
2021-12-02 17:37:42
169阅读
哇哈哈,昨天看到动易出补丁了,甚是郁闷,俺拿到这个0day都还没开始玩,就这样被洗白鸟,郁闷啊,早知道不玩动易主站,而且是get提交方式,当初如果听CN的话,也许这个0day还会一直埋在地下,刚看了下动易的补丁,这次补的地方不至这一个,哈哈,传说的7个以上的bug,不知道还省几个呢?下面是大概一个月前写的东西,发出来给大家搞一些懒惰的管理员,补丁都发2天了,还没补的话,就是管理员的错了哦,呵呵~~
转载
精选
2006-11-20 14:22:00
2245阅读
首先,训练数据源,分为正样本和负样本。先区分正负样本的文件夹,结构如下:cmd执行的指令 harresult训练集合生成的结果文件夹,需要自行创建 negative负样本文件夹 positive正样本文件夹####开始发车 ###(一)创建正负样本的目录说明文件 win电脑cmd窗口,可以输入dir/s/b>1.txt用于生成目录说明文件 (1)下图为正样本目录说明文件截图第一列是图
转载
2023-08-02 20:19:24
352阅读
1.抽象abstract类概述假设定义一个动物类Animal,其中有一个move方法,用来模拟动物的移动行为,它有多个子类,例如,猫类和鸟类,显然这两种动物的move方法需要不同的实现,也就是它们都需要重写父类的move方法,例如:class Animal{
public void move(){
System.out.println("Animal move()");
转载
2024-01-15 08:20:19
287阅读